Several key factors are propelling the growth of the ethylene glycol ether acetate market. The escalating demand from the chemical industry, primarily as solvents and intermediates in various chemical processes, is a major contributor. The metal industry's increasing utilization of these acetates as components in coatings, paints, and cleaning agents further fuels market expansion. Advances in technology resulting in the development of high-performance ethylene glycol ether acetates with improved properties, such as enhanced solubility and lower toxicity, also contribute significantly. The expansion of the construction and automotive industries in developing economies is boosting demand for coatings and paints, consequently increasing the need for these crucial components. Furthermore, favorable government policies and initiatives aimed at promoting industrial growth in certain regions are driving investment and production, further stimulating market growth. Finally, the versatile nature of ethylene glycol ether acetates, allowing for applications across multiple sectors, adds to its overall market appeal and assures continued demand across various industry verticals.
Despite the positive growth trajectory, the ethylene glycol ether acetate market faces several challenges. Fluctuations in the prices of raw materials, particularly ethylene glycol, significantly impact production costs and profitability. Stringent environmental regulations regarding the use of volatile organic compounds (VOCs) pose a considerable constraint, necessitating the development of environmentally friendly alternatives or modifications to existing production processes. The intense competition among numerous market players leads to price wars, reducing profit margins. Furthermore, economic downturns or slowdowns in major consuming industries can significantly impact demand, affecting overall market growth. The potential for health and safety concerns related to certain types of ethylene glycol ether acetates, especially those with higher toxicity levels, necessitates careful handling and adherence to safety protocols, posing an additional challenge. Addressing these challenges requires innovation in production processes, research into more sustainable alternatives, and strategic pricing strategies to maintain profitability in a competitive environment.
